首页
/ Theseus-Ship 项目启动与配置教程

Theseus-Ship 项目启动与配置教程

2025-05-03 12:53:26作者:钟日瑜

1. 项目的目录结构及介绍

Theseus-Ship 项目的目录结构如下所示:

theseus-ship/
├── .gitignore
├── README.md
├── config
│   └── config.json
├── docs
│   └── ...
├── scripts
│   └── ...
├── src
│   ├── main
│   │   └── ...
│   └── test
│       └── ...
└── ...
  • .gitignore:此文件指定了哪些文件和目录应该被 Git 忽略。
  • README.md:项目的说明文件,包含了项目的基本信息和如何使用项目的说明。
  • config:配置文件目录,包含了项目的配置文件。
  • docs:文档目录,存放项目的文档资料。
  • scripts:脚本目录,包含了项目的脚本文件,如启动脚本、构建脚本等。
  • src:源代码目录,包含了项目的主要源代码,分为maintest两个子目录。

2. 项目的启动文件介绍

Theseus-Ship 项目的启动文件通常位于 src/main 目录下。具体的启动文件可能因项目具体实现而异,但通常会包括以下几种:

  • index.jsindex.py:这是 Node.js 或 Python 项目的入口文件,通常会包含启动应用的主要逻辑。
  • main.jsmain.py:同样是入口文件,与index.jsindex.py类似,具体取决于使用的语言。

启动文件通常会负责以下任务:

  • 初始化项目所依赖的模块和库。
  • 配置项目环境。
  • 启动服务器或执行其他必要的操作。

3. 项目的配置文件介绍

Theseus-Ship 项目的配置文件通常位于 config 目录下,例如 config.json。配置文件用于定义项目运行时所需的各种参数和设置。

以下是一个简单的配置文件示例:

{
  "port": 3000,
  "database": {
    "host": "localhost",
    "user": "root",
    "password": "password",
    "dbname": "theseus_ship"
  },
  "featureFlags": {
    "enableNewFeature": true
  }
}

在这个配置文件中:

  • port:指定了应用运行的端口号。
  • database:包含了数据库连接的配置信息。
  • featureFlags:定义了项目的功能特性标志,用于开启或关闭某些功能特性。

配置文件可以根据实际需求包含更多的配置项,这些配置项会在项目运行时被读取和使用,从而无需硬编码在源代码中。

登录后查看全文
热门项目推荐